The Making of Champagne: A Trip From Vine to Glass

The voyage of a Champagne bottle is a fascinating tale that spans from the sun-drenched vineyards of Champagne region to your celebratory toast. It all starts with meticulous cultivation champagne of the finest grapes, carefully picked for their potential. These essential berries are then gathered at the peak of maturity and transported to nearby Champagne cellar, where their journey into the iconic beverage begins.

  • Crafting champagne involves a delicate process of pressing the grapes, followed by conversion to create a bubbly base wine.
  • Second fermentation occurs in bottle, trapping the carbon dioxide and giving Champagne its signature fizz.
  • Maturation is crucial to developing Champagne's layered characteristics . Bottles are patiently kept in the dark, cool cellars for years, allowing the wine to mature.

Ultimately, after meticulous tasting, each bottle is tagged and ready to be shipped worldwide. From the rolling hills of Champagne to your glass, every step in this process is a testament to the dedication and craft that make Champagne a truly special beverage.

Decoding the Label: Comprehending Champagne Classifications

A trip to the champagne aisle can be a daunting experience. With numerous labels showcasing intricate classifications, it's easy to feel overwhelmed. Decoding these labels is crucial for navigating the world of bubbly and selecting the perfect bottle for your occasion. Beginnings with understanding the core elements that define champagne classification.

  • Technique| How they're made: Champagne is crafted using the traditional method, where a further fermentation occurs in the bottle, creating those signature fizzing.
  • Territory of Origin: The soul of champagne originates from the Champagne in France.
  • Vintage Designation: Particular years may be labeled as vintage champagne, indicating a exceptional harvest.
